Natural weaving

Natural weaving with a ‘Y’ branch This type of natural weaving involves gathering your own natural materials including a natural loom. A ‘Y’ shape stick works really well for this. Hermit crab

Let’s hear it for the hermit crab. The bargain hunters of the ocean. They don’t aspire to Kevin McCloud and go building there own ‘Grand Designs’.  Hermit Crabs are thrifty and make use of those designs that other molluscs have left behind.
